WW GRILLED ZUCCHINI WITH LEMON-HERB FETA



WW Grilled Zucchini With Lemon-Herb Feta image

Given this recipe at my WW meeting and with all the Zucchini in my garden wanted something different to make. With it's tangy feta topping this fit the bill. It would also be good on grilled eggplant and pepper. Only 1 pointPlus value per serving

Provided by Bonnie G 2

Categories     Vegetable

Time 25m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

3 tablespoons feta cheese, crumbled
2 tablespoons mint leaves, minced
1 tablspoon extra virgin olive oil
1 teaspoon lemon juice, fresh
1 teaspoon lemon zest
2 scallions, minced
4 zucchini, about 1 . 5 pounds
4 sprays cooking spray
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t

Steps:

  • In small bowl, cobine feta, mint,oil, lemon juice, lemon zest and scallions; set aside.
  • Trim ends off zucchini and slice in half lengthwise.
  • Slice each half into 4 or 5 chunks.
  • Place on flat surface in single layer.
  • Coat both sides with cooking spray and sprinle with salt.
  • Off heat, coat grill rack or grill pan with cooking spray.
  • Heat over high heat.
  • Cook zucchini, flipping once until grill marks are evident and zucchini is soft, 3 to 4 minutes per side.
  • Arrange on platter and serve with feta topping.
  • Yields about 5-6 chunks zucchini and 1 tablespoon feta topping per ser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 43.3, Fat 1.9, SaturatedFat 1.2, Cholesterol 6.3, Sodium 284.5, Carbohydrate 4.9, Fiber 1.5, Sugar 3.7, Protein 2.7

GRILLED ZUCCHINI WITH LEMON-HERB FETA



Grilled Zucchini with Lemon-Herb Feta image

This quick side gives zucchini the star treatment. It is an ideal recipe to make when you already have the grill fired up or for a speedy indoor option in your grill pan. Resist the urge to flip the zucchini more than once, otherwise you won't get those coveted grill marks that bring so much flavor and visual appeal to this dish. The fresh flavor of mint complements the tangy feta, but you can substitute any fresh herb you like or have on hand. You'll need half of a lemon to yield the amount of zest and juice needed for this recipe.

Categories     Lunch

Time 23m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

3 Tbsp Crumbled feta cheese
2 Tbsp Mint leaves minced
1 Tbsp Olive oil extra virgin
1 tsp Fresh lemon juice
1 tsp Lemon zest
2 medium Uncooked scallion(s) minced
4 small Uncooked zucchini about 1 1/2 lbs
4 spray(s) Cooking spray
0.5 tsp Kosher salt

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ine feta, mint, oil, lemon juice, lemon zest and scallions; set aside.
  • Trim ends off zucchini and slice in half lengthwise; slice each half into 4 or 5 chunks. Place zucchini on a baking sheet (or other flat surface) in a single layer; coat both sides with cooking spray and sprinkle with salt.
  • Off heat, coat a grill rack or grill pan with cooking spray; heat over high heat. Cook zucchini, carefully flipping once, until grill marks are evident and zucchini is softened, about 3 to 4 minutes per side. Arrange zucchini slices on a platter and serve with reserved feta topping.
  • Serving size: about 5 pieces zucchini and 1 heaping Tbsp feta topping

Nutrition Facts : Calories 30 kcal

GRILLED ZUCCHINI WITH FETA AND LEMON



Grilled zucchini with feta and lemon image

This simple-to-prepare side is proof that a handful of ingredients can produce delicious results in a short amount of time. Feel free to use a mix of fresh zucchini and yellow summer squash to add a bit more color. You could toss in a small handful of fresh herbs to the feta mixture, using one herb or a mix of whatever you've got. This dish also easily double or triples if you're serving a crowd.

Categories     Lunch,Dinner

Time 20m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

4 spray(s) Cooking spray
0.5 cup(s) Reduced-fat feta cheese crumbled
3 medium Uncooked scallion(s) thinly sliced
1 Tbsp Extra virgin olive oil
2 tsp Lemon zest grated
24 oz Uncooked zucchini ends trimmed
0.5 tsp Kosher salt
0.25 tsp Black pepper

Steps:

  • Off heat, coat grill rack or grill pan with nonstick spray. Preheat gas grill or grill pan to high, or prepare high fire in charcoal grill.
  • In small bowl, stir cheese, scallions, oil, and lemon zest for topping. Halve zucchini lengthwise and cut each half into 4 or 5 pieces. Transfer zucchini to large bowl. Lightly coat zucchini with nonstick spray. Season with salt and pepper and toss to coat.
  • Grill zucchini, turning occasionally, until tender, charred, and marked from grill, about 6 minutes. Transfer zucchini to platter or serving bowl. Sprinkle with feta topping.
  • Serving size: about 5 zucchini pieces and 1 heaping tbsp feta topping

Nutrition Facts : Calories 34 kcal

GRILLED ZUCCHINI WITH HERB SALT AND FETA



Grilled Zucchini with Herb Salt and Feta image

Provided by Trisha Yearwood

Categories     side-dish

Time 15m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/2 cup kosher salt
1 1/2 teaspoons dried oregano
1 1/2 teaspoons dried thyme
3 medium zucchini, ends trimmed, sliced lengthwise into 1/4-inch-thick planks
Olive oil, for brushing
1/2 cup crumbled feta cheese

Steps:

  • For the herb salt: Combine the salt, oregano and thyme in a small bowl and mix to blend.
  • For the grilled zucchini: Brush the zucchini planks on both sides with olive oil and sprinkle on both sides with some of the herb salt. Transfer the zucchini to a grill pan set over medium heat and cook until tender, about 5 minutes, flipping halfway through. Remove the zucchini to a serving plate and sprinkle with the feta.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 104 calorie, Fat 8 grams, SaturatedFat 3 grams, Cholesterol 17 milligrams, Sodium 341 milligrams, Carbohydrate 5 grams, Fiber 1 grams, Protein 4 grams, Sugar 4 grams

SAUTéED ZUCCHINI WITH LEMON



Sautéed Zucchini With Lemon image

One more thing to do with all that zucchini from the garden. This is a quick, good, and easy side dish that can be served with a weeknight family meal as well as a fancy dinner. Goes great with grilled chicken or even a nice snack on its own.

Provided by littleturtle

Categories     Lunch/Snacks

Time 20m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 tablespoons olive oil
1 1/2 tablespoons butter
3 -4 zucchini, washed, ends trimmed, and cut in half
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on pepper
1/3 cup flour
2 tablespoons soy sauce
1 tablespoon lemon juice

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, heat the butter and oil over medium heat.
  • Cut each zucchini half lengthwise into 4 pieces.
  • Season the flour with salt & pepper, then coat with the zucchini with flour.
  • Sauté zucchini in oil and butter until cooked through but not mushy, turning to brown on all sides (5-10 minutes).
  • When done, turn heat to low, and add soy sauce and lemon juice.
  • Serve promptly.

GRILLED ZUCCHINI AND FETA TOASTS



Grilled Zucchini and Feta Toasts image

Though its flavor is subtle, zucchini absorbs seasonings readily, and develops deep complexity when grilled. In this recipe, the grilled squash is doused with a flavorful oil made with garlic, cumin and coriander. If you have extra time, marinate the grilled zucchini pieces in the spice oil for up to 24 hours to help build flavor. You can serve the dish hot off the grill, or prepare in advance, then serve at room temperature.

Provided by Sue Li

Categories     dinner, lunch, quick, weeknight, appetizer, main course

Time 30m

Yield 2 to 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 medium zucchini (about 1 pound), trimmed and halved lengthwise
1/2 cup olive oil
Kosher salt and black pepper
4 thick slices country or sourdough bread
4 garlic cloves, thinly sliced
1 teaspoon cumin seeds, lightly crushed
1 teaspoon coriander seeds, lightly crushed
1 teaspoon red-pepper flakes
Grilled bread, for serving
3 ounces feta, crumbled into large pieces
Lemon wedges, for serving

Steps:

  • Heat a grill or grill pan over medium-high and brush the grates clean, if grilling outdoors.
  • With a small spoon, scrape the seeds from the middle of zucchini halves and discard. Rub zucchini with 2 tablespoons olive oil and season with salt and pepper. Place zucchini halves onto grill, cut-sides down, and cook until charred on both sides, turning halfway through, 10 to 15 minutes. Transfer grilled zucchini onto a cutting board, let cool slightly then cut into bite-size pieces.
  • While zucchini grills, brush bread on both sides with 2 tablespoons olive oil. Grill until lightly charred on both sides, about 5 minutes. Transfer to a serving platter.
  • While zucchini and bread grill, prepare the spice oil: Heat remaining 1/4 cup oil in a small saucepan over medium-low until hot. Stir in the garlic, cumin seeds, coriander seeds and red-pepper flakes, and remove from heat. The residual heat from the oil will cook the garlic and spices. Transfer spice oil to a large bowl, add grilled zucchini and toss to combine.
  • Spoon zucchini over grilled bread and top with large pieces of feta. Serve with lemon wedges for squeezing on top.

GRILLED ZUCCHINI AND BULGUR SALAD WITH FETA AND PRESERVED-LEMON DRESSING



Grilled Zucchini and Bulgur Salad With Feta and Preserved-Lemon Dressing image

Charred zucchini pairs particularly well with the deep savory notes of preserved-lemon paste and the tang of creamy feta in this salad.

Provided by Hetty McKinnon

Time 45m

Yield 4 main-course servings or 6-8 side serv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 cup raw walnuts
1 cup coarse-grind bulgur
¼ tsp. kosher salt, plus more
2 lb. zucchini and/or yellow summer squash
¼ cup extra-virgin olive oil, plus more for drizzling
3 Tbsp. preserved lemon paste (such as NY Shuk)
2 tsp. honey
1 garlic clove, finely grated
Freshly ground black pepper
7 oz. Greek feta, crumbled
½ cup coarsely chopped parsley
½ cup torn mint leaves
Lemon wedges (for serving)

Steps:

  • Toast walnuts in a dry medium skillet over medium heat, tossing often, until golden brown, 8-10 minutes. Transfer to a cutting board and let cool. Coarsely chop.
  • Wipe out skillet and toast bulgur, stirring often, until a shade darker and starting to smell like popcorn, about 3 minutes. Add ¼ tsp. salt and 2 cups water and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low and simmer gently until liquid is almost completely evaporated, 8-10 minutes. Cover skillet and remove from heat. Let sit while you prepare the rest of the salad.
  • Prepare a grill for high heat. (Or, heat a grill pan over high.) Trim ends of zucchini; slice lengthwise into long ¼"-thick planks. Set a wire rack inside a rimmed baking sheet and arrange zucchini in a single layer on rack (you can also do this in a large bowl if you don't have a wire rack). Drizzle with oil and season with salt. Toss zucchini, rubbing with your hands, to coat completely with oil.
  • Grill zucchini, undisturbed, until grill marks appear, about 2 minutes. Turn over and grill on other side until grill marks appear, about 2 minutes. Return to wire rack (or a colander set in a bowl) to drain; let cool slightly, Transfer to a cutting board and slice on a diagonal into 1" pieces.
  • Whisk preserved lemon paste, honey, garlic, and remaining ¼ cup oil in a large bowl to combine; season with pepper (lemon paste and feta should make it salty enough). Add bulgur and feta and toss to combine. Set some of zucchini, parsley, and mint aside for serving, then add remaining zucchini and herbs to salad; toss gently to combine. Taste and season with salt and pepper if needed.
  • Transfer salad to a platter. Top with reserved zucchini and herbs. Scatter walnuts over. Serve salad with lemon wedges for squeezing over.
